What Are Professional Event Production Services?

Event production is the process of bringing the technical and entertainment elements of an event together so they support the same overall objective.

For a corporate event, that could mean creating polished background music during networking, providing clear microphones for presentations, supporting awards or recognitions, and then increasing the energy later in the evening.

For a wedding, it may involve ceremony audio, cocktail-hour music, introductions, professional MC services, microphones for toasts, special dances, lighting, open dancing, and coordination with the planner, photographer, catering team, and venue.

For a product launch, production might include music, branded visuals, microphones, lighting changes, announcements, video content, and carefully timed transitions surrounding the product reveal.

The equipment matters, but equipment is only a tool.

A successful production also requires preparation, communication, judgment, timing, adaptability, and an understanding of how guests are responding throughout the event.

Professional Audio and Microphones

Clear sound is one of the foundations of a successful event.

The appropriate audio system depends on several factors, including:

  • Guest count
  • Room size and layout
  • Indoor or outdoor location
  • Number of presentation areas
  • Whether guests are seated or moving throughout the space
  • Whether the event includes dancing
  • Number and type of microphones required
  • Presentations, panels, speeches, or entertainment
  • Existing venue AV infrastructure

The goal is not simply to make an event loud.

The goal is to provide appropriate sound coverage for the people who actually need to hear it while managing volume according to what is happening in the room.

Networking and dinner may require comfortable background levels. A keynote requires clarity. A dance floor requires a completely different level of energy.

That progression should be intentional.

Event Flow and Professional MC Services

One of the most overlooked components of event production is event flow.

Someone needs to understand:

  • What happens next
  • When guests need to know about it
  • When music should change
  • When microphones are required
  • When a speaker should be introduced
  • When an award is being presented
  • When photographs need to happen
  • When a product is being revealed
  • When the room needs more energy
  • When the room needs less energy

How to Plan Event Production in Fort Worth: A 5-Step Framework

Step 1: Start With the Purpose of the Event

Before deciding how many speakers or lights are needed, define what the event is supposed to accomplish.

A corporate networking reception has a different objective than an awards gala.

A grand opening needs a different energy than a formal dinner.

A wedding reception is different from a conference.

A product launch may have a specific moment around which much of the production is built.

Ask questions such as:

  • What should guests feel when they arrive?
  • What are the most important moments?
  • Is conversation a priority?
  • Will there be presentations?
  • Is dancing part of the event?
  • Will there be sponsor recognition?
  • Are there giveaways, games, raffles, or awards?
  • Will there be video presentations?
  • What should guests remember afterward?

Once the purpose is clear, production decisions become much easier.

Step 2: Evaluate the Venue and Technical Requirements

Every venue is different.

Before finalizing a production plan, consider:

  • Guest capacity
  • Room dimensions
  • Ceiling height
  • Indoor versus outdoor areas
  • Stage location
  • Dance-floor location
  • Seating layout
  • Speaker placement
  • Power availability
  • Load-in and load-out access
  • Available setup time
  • Existing venue sound or lighting
  • Natural light if video or projection will be used
  • Sightlines to screens
  • Microphone requirements
  • Separate ceremony, cocktail, presentation, or reception areas

A warehouse-style venue may require a different audio approach than a hotel ballroom. A small private dining room requires a different solution than a large conference hall.

The objective is to design the system around the event rather than force the event around the equipment.

Step 3: Build a Run of Show

A run of show is one of the most useful planning tools for a complex event.

It can include:

  • Guest arrival
  • Cocktail or networking periods
  • Welcome remarks
  • Introductions
  • Dinner
  • Presentations
  • Toasts
  • Awards
  • Sponsor recognition
  • Giveaways
  • Raffles
  • Product reveals
  • Special dances
  • Games or activities
  • Karaoke
  • Open dancing
  • Final announcements
  • Grand exits

Not every event requires a minute-by-minute script, but important moments should be identified before guests arrive.

For each major moment, determine:

Who is involved?
Who introduces it?
What microphone is required?
Is specific music needed?
Does the lighting need to change?
Does a photographer or videographer need advance notice?
What happens immediately afterward?

That level of preparation helps eliminate awkward pauses and confusing transitions.

Step 4: Coordinate the Vendor Team

Event production rarely happens in isolation.

The DJ, MC, venue staff, planner, catering team, photographer, videographer, AV technicians, entertainers, speakers, and other vendors may all affect the event timeline.

Professional coordination does not mean the DJ replaces your event planner or production manager.

It means your entertainment professional understands his role within the larger team and communicates appropriately with the people responsible for the other pieces of the event.

For example, before announcing an important wedding moment, the photographer should be ready.

Before introducing a corporate keynote, the appropriate microphone and presentation should be ready.

Before a product reveal, everyone responsible for music, lighting, video, and announcements should understand the cue.

Smooth transitions are rarely accidental.

Essential Elements of High-Impact Fort Worth Event Production

Music and Energy Management

Not every part of an event should have the same energy.

This is an important distinction.

During a corporate cocktail hour, music may need to support networking without competing with conversation.

At a wedding, cocktail hour and dinner should feel different from introductions and open dancing.

At a grand opening, music should create excitement while leaving room for promotions, announcements, customer interaction, and giveaways.

At a fundraiser, the entertainment needs to support the organization’s mission rather than distract from it.

Professional energy management means understanding when to build momentum and when to allow the room to breathe.

Crowd Reading

A playlist created before an event is only a starting point.

People in the room provide real-time information.

A DJ should be watching:

  • Which songs are connecting
  • Which age groups are responding
  • Whether guests are dancing or socializing
  • Whether energy is increasing or declining
  • Which genres are working
  • Whether a change in tempo is needed
  • When to transition between decades or musical styles
  • When a requested song is most likely to make an impact

A Fort Worth Event Production Planning Checklist

Before requesting a production quote, consider the following:

  • What type of event are you planning?
  • What is the date?
  • Where is the venue?
  • How many guests are expected?
  • Is the event indoors, outdoors, or both?
  • What are the start and end times?
  • When can vendors begin loading in?
  • Is there a stage?
  • Is there a dance floor?
  • Will there be speeches or presentations?
  • How many microphones are required?
  • Will there be video presentations?
  • Does the venue already have screens or AV equipment?
  • Will you need lighting?
  • Are there branding requirements?
  • Are there specific musical preferences?
  • Will you need professional MC services?
  • Are there awards, raffles, giveaways, or product reveals?
  • Are there multiple rooms or event areas?
  • Who is managing the overall timeline?
  • Which moments are most important to you?

You do not need to have every answer before contacting an event production company.

A good production conversation should help identify the questions you have not considered yet.
